Vieille Réserve, No. 9, Grande Champagne, matured for 50 years in oak casks.
The AE Dor Vieille Réserve No 9 is truly a special Cognac. A very limited release, offered as part of their precious numbered, Vieilles Reserve range of rare Cognacs. The story behind No 9 is fascinating. After languishing in oak barrels for around 50 years, the eau-de-vie was transferred into wax-sealed demijohns. When this particular concept is applied, the Cognac then ceases to age further, nor does the alcohol content continue to naturally reduce. It was in 1964 when the Cellar Master concluded that the Cognac was at the perfect point for this to occur. And there it sat until the house of A.E. Dor deemed it ready to bottle.
Thanks to this such a Cognac retains its vigor and personality, so you can be assured that you're enjoying a Cognac that's as perfect as it was over half a century ago.
